Workers Unite! is thrilled to announce that our venue of the past several years, Cinema Village, has listened to our ongoing ideas about unions and joined the great labor union upsurge this past year. They just voted to unionize last month and are in final negotiations now.

The massive Labor Upsurge of 2023 was a wonder to behold as SAG-AFTRA, The Writers Guild, Nurses, the UPS Teamsters and the UAW, just to name a few of such unions, led the charge for organizing workers and proved what the results can be for direct action by organized and committed union members.  The Workers Unite Film Festival stands with all these unions and new labor groups, such as the Amazon Labor Union and the Starbucks Workers Unions across the country.
